相关文章
C++中的vector使用与实现
一、vector的使用
1.1 vector的定义
是一种类模板
template < class T, class Alloc allocator<T> >
class vector;
其中的模板参数Alloc是在使用空间配置器(内存池),并给了缺省值,暂时不深究
1.2遍历方式
1.…
编程日记
2024/11/15 11:37:02
Facebook的AI驱动发展:人工智能如何改变社交体验
个性化内容推荐
Facebook利用AI算法分析用户的行为数据,包括点赞、评论、分享和浏览历史。这些数据使得平台能够深入了解用户的兴趣和偏好,从而提供个性化的内容推荐。例如,用户在浏览动态时,AI系统会根据用户的互动历史…
编程日记
2024/11/15 2:47:38
localStorage、sessionStorage 和 cookie哪个好?
目录
1. 数据存储大小
2. 生命周期
3. 安全性
4. 访问方式
5. 数据传输
6. 适用场景 在现代Web开发中,客户端数据存储的方式通常分为三种:localStorage、sessionStorage 和 cookie。它们各自有着不同的特性,适用于不同的场景。为了更好…
编程日记
2024/11/13 21:13:02
Spring Boot应用开发
Spring Boot应用开发是一个广泛而深入的话题,以下是对Spring Boot应用开发的详细阐述:
一、Spring Boot简介 Spring Boot是一个基于Spring框架的轻量级开发框架,它简化了Spring应用的开发过程,提供了一套预设的开发规范和约束&am…
编程日记
2024/11/12 12:59:06
【MySQL】滑动窗口函数详解
MySQL中窗口函数详解 1️⃣什么是滑动窗口2️⃣ MySQL中的滑动窗口函数 1️⃣什么是滑动窗口
首先,分享一道leetcode题,滑动窗口最大值
问题描述:
给你一个整数数组 nums,有一个大小为 k 的滑动窗口从数组的最左侧移动到数组的…
编程日记
2024/11/13 21:21:49
同一个交换机不同vlan的设备为什么不能通信
在同一个交换机上,不同 VLAN 的设备不能直接通信,这是因为 VLAN(虚拟局域网)通过在数据链路层(OSI 第2层)对设备进行逻辑隔离,将不同 VLAN 的设备视为属于不同的网络。具体原因如下:…
编程日记
2024/11/13 21:21:32
SAP推出AI支出管理解决方案
SAP公司近日宣布,已将其生成式人工智能助手Joule整合至SAP Ariba和SAP Fieldglass的支出管理解决方案中,以增强企业在战略协作、生产力、合规性和业务洞察等方面的能力。这一消息是在10月15日于拉斯维加斯举行的SAP Spend Connect Live大会上发布的。嵌入…
编程日记
2024/11/13 21:13:17
五、事务和并发控制及索引和性能优化
一. 事务和并发控制是数据库管理系统中用于处理多个用户并发访问共享数据的重要机制。
下面是对事务和并发控制的详细讲解和示例说明:事务: 事务是一组数据库操作的逻辑单元,它要么全部执行成功,要么全部回滚。事务通过保证数据操…
编程日记
2024/11/13 21:13:11